Intervention on the Ebola Crisis by President Jacob Zuma, during the 24th Ordinary Session of the Assembly of the African Union Heads of State and Government, Addis Ababa (The Presidency of the Republic of South Africa)

(Source: The Presidency of the Republic of South Africa) 30 January 2015 Chairperson,#160; South Africa would like to commend the efforts of the United Nations, African Union, Governments of the affected countries and stakeholders against the Ebola Virus Disease outbreak.#160; It is through the on-going response of these role players that the tide of the Ebola Virus Disease outbreak has taken a positive turn and that we are seeing a steady decline of cases. South Africa also wishes to congratulate Senegal, Nigeria, the Democratic Republic of Congo and Mali on stopping the spread of Ebola in their countries.
